LIVE REVIEW: The Creators in The Grand Social
A packed Grand Social greeted this debut show by R&B supergroup The Creators.
The brainchild of seasoned vocalist (who also plays a mean harmonica) Rory Wilson, The Creators feature the talents of Conor Brady (The Frames), Rob Malone (Lir/David Gray) and former Frame Johnny Boyle.
After a stellar support slot from punk combo Checkpoint, Rory and co took to the stage and blitzed through a high octane set of originals and choice covers.
Songs such as ‘Break The Chain’, ‘Bulletproof’ and ‘Sniff, Lick and Split’ prove he has the songwriting chops in spades, each a perfectly crafted nugget of Dr Feelgoodesque sublimity. Appropriate then that ‘Down At The Doctors’ is among the gems that gets a potent reworking at the hands of these maestros.
The quality of musicianship on display is eye-watering and the chemistry between the four makes for a compelling live experience that left the crowd baying for more at curfew. They are currently lined up to support Wilko Johnson on his forthcoming Dublin jaunt. He may want to watch his back!
